County brief

What the local evidence says

01Decision frame

Marion County presents a price-direction conflict rather than a clean entry signal. Zillow’s $163,358 county median home value in 2026-06 was down 1.96% year over year, while the annual 2025 FHFA repeat-transaction HPI rose 8.19%. Those are different vintages and methods—an index is not a home value—so they cannot be averaged. Buyers able to validate parcel-level economics should investigate; income underwriting should remain cautious.

02Housing economics

Housing economics cannot yet turn that value evidence into yield. Market rent is not published, so gross yield cannot be computed. The $776 HUD FMR is a payment standard, not a market asking-rent estimate. The effective property-tax rate is 0.28%, and the supplied median annual tax is $301, but neither establishes the tax bill on a specific asset. Lease comparables, utilities, insurance and maintenance evidence are not published, preventing a net-cash-flow conclusion.

03Demand & competition

Realtor.com’s 2026-06 MLS listing market points to a slower visible selling environment: 90 active listings were 9.09% higher year over year, median marketing time was 75 days, 17.42% of listings had price reductions, and the pending-to-active ratio was 24.44%. These are asking-price, supply, marketing-time and seller-concession evidence, not closed-sale prices or proof of demand. Net migration was positive and incoming movers reported higher average income than outgoing movers, but that tax-return evidence does not establish tenant demand. Investor purchases were a small share of total purchases. QCEW shows annual covered workplace employment declined while average weekly wage rose; manufacturing is the largest disclosed private supersector, not the whole economy.

04Risk & next checks

Inland flood is the dominant hazard, and the modeled annual expected building-value loss ratio is 0.17%; it should be reconciled with parcel flood zone, elevation, prior losses and an insurance quote, not converted to a dollar loss from this record. Obtain closed-sale comps to test MLS signals and property-level tax bills to test carrying costs. The record does not publish market rent, insurance terms, condition or flood-mitigation details; without them, rent coverage, net cash flow and hazard-adjusted pricing remain unresolved.

Bear case

What can break the county thesis

  1. Published FMR may be mistaken for achievable market rent, leaving income and yield unsupported.
  2. Parcel-level flood exposure, insurance pricing and mitigation needs may differ materially from the county modeled loss ratio.
  3. MLS listing conditions may not translate into closed-sale pricing, buyer depth or actual transaction liquidity.
